Fate


Not to think of God  
Is my tragic fate.  
Not to pray to God  
Is my hostile fate.  
Not to meditate on God  
Is my unthinkable fate.
Not to love God  
Is my unforgivable fate.
But to become eventually another God
Is my inexorable fate.

FATE 

Human fate,
I am afraid of you.
Divine fate,
I am fond of you.

Human fate,  
You remind me  
Of the things I cannot do,
Which are far beyond my capacity.

Divine fate,  
You tell me
That nothing is beyond my capacity,
Absolutely nothing,  
For I am of God-Height  
And  
For God-Depth.

- By: Sri Chinmoy
